I have installed Virtual Serial Port Control and I am able to create a port and see the data that is being forwarded by using the windows type command  
     type "text.txt" >> COM7
This command lets me see the output to the port COM7 on the data filter program.
 
However, when I try this with a different program that communicates with COM7 The data filter program shows that the port open and closes but no data comes through the port.
 
The issues is that the program using the virtual port opens the port but waits for the port to reply back with the number 12. However, since the Virtual Serial Port Control does not reply to the request made by the program the program never sends the data. So is there anyways I can reply to the request from the virtual port?
